💡 Understanding What an Inverter Does
An inverter converts DC (direct current) power from your solar panels or batteries into AC (alternating current) electricity used by your appliances. Without the right size inverter, even the best panel or battery system will perform poorly.
Choosing the wrong size inverter can lead to:
- Overloads that cause shutdowns
- Reduced efficiency
- Poor battery performance
- Safety and compliance risks
Selecting the correct size ensures smooth performance, safety, and long-term savings.
⚙️ Step 1: Know Your Power Consumption
Start by identifying how much power your home or business uses. Check the wattage label on each appliance and add up the total power needed when multiple devices run simultaneously.
Example Residential Load (No Tables — Clean “Description: Value” Format)
Appliance List:
- LED Lights: 10 × 10W = 100W
- Fridge: 1 × 200W = 200W
- TV: 1 × 150W = 150W
- Wi-Fi Router: 1 × 20W = 20W
- Computer: 1 × 300W = 300W
- Washing Machine: 1 × 800W = 800W
Total Running Load: 1 570W (1.6kW)
Add a 20–25% safety buffer for efficiency and heat loss:
Recommended Inverter Size: 2kW – 3kW for a small home.

🏢 Step 2: Identify Your Power Demand Type
🟢 Residential Inverters
Most homes use single-phase (230V). Typical inverter sizes:
- 3kW — small homes or essential loads
- 5kW — medium homes
- 8kW — full-home backup (most popular)

🟠 Commercial & Industrial Inverters
Larger properties may require three-phase (380–415V) inverters for heavier machinery or air-conditioning.
Typical Sizes: 10kW – 100kW+

🔋 Step 3: Match Your Battery & Solar Array
Your inverter size must be compatible with your battery bank and solar panels.
Common Pairings (No Columns):
- 12V systems: Small setups under 1.5kW
- 24V systems: Medium-sized homes up to 3kW
- 48V systems: Homes & small businesses (5kW – 12kW)
- High-Voltage systems: Commercial systems 10kW+

⚡ Step 4: Factor in Peak Power (Surge Capacity)
Some appliances draw 2–3× their rated power at startup. Your inverter must handle this surge.
Examples:
- 1kW fridge → 2.5kW surge
- Washing machine → 4kW surge
- Pool pump → 5kW surge
This is why many homes choose a 5kW or 8kW inverter even if their running load is only 2–3kW.
🔍 Step 5: Choose the Right Inverter Type
Grid-Tied Inverter
Description: Feeds solar power into the grid.
Ideal For: Homes & businesses reducing Eskom costs.
Notes: No battery support.
Hybrid Inverter
Description: Supports solar + battery storage.
Ideal For: Load-shedding protection & energy independence.

Off-Grid Inverter
Description: Fully independent system.
Ideal For: Farms, remote areas, and rural properties.

🧮 Step 6: Example — How to Size Your Inverter
Running Load: 3 500W
Surge Load: 5 000W
Step 1: Add 25% buffer:
3 500W × 1.25 = 4 375W
Step 2: Recommended Inverter: 5kW Hybrid Inverter

🧰 Why Professional Sizing Matters
Correct inverter sizing is not guesswork. A professional installer considers:
- Actual load profiles over 24 hours
- Voltage drop calculations
- Cable and breaker compatibility
- Roof orientation for PV design
- Battery discharge rates and future expansion
Incorrect DIY sizing frequently results in:
- Overloading and shutdowns
- Reduced battery lifespan
- Poor backup performance
- Damaged inverters and voided warranties
